Property valuation is an essential process that determines the monetary worth of a property, be it residential, commercial, or industrial. It involves a comprehensive analysis of the property’s location, condition, size, amenities, and other relevant factors to establish its fair market value. In today’s dynamic real estate market, accurate property valuations play a crucial role in various scenarios, such as buying or selling properties, securing mortgage loans, settling legal disputes, and determining property taxes.

The process of property valuation is undertaken by certified and experienced professionals known as valuers or appraisers. These experts employ different methods and techniques to assess a property’s value objectively and impartially. They consider factors like recent sales data of similar properties in the area, current market conditions, zoning regulations, and potential future developments that may impact the value of the property. A precise property valuation allows property owners and buyers to make informed decisions based on its true worth and ensures fair transactions in the real estate market.

Methods of Property Valuation

There are several methods that valuers use to determine the value of a property. The most common methods include the sales comparison approach, income approach, and cost approach.

The sales comparison approach involves analyzing recent sales data of similar properties in the area. Valuers compare the subject property to recently sold properties with similar characteristics, such as size, condition, location, and amenities. This approach is most commonly used for residential properties.

On the other hand, the income approach is commonly used for commercial and investment properties. In this method, valuers estimate the value of a property based on its potential income-generating capabilities. They consider factors such as rental rates, occupancy rates, operating expenses, and market demand.

Lastly, the cost approach is often used for new or unique properties that don’t have sufficient comparable sales data. Valuers calculate the cost to rebuild or replace the property, considering its age, condition, and current construction costs.

Importance of Commercial Property Valuation

Commercial property valuation is crucial for various stakeholders in the real estate industry. Investors rely on accurate valuations to make informed decisions about buying or selling commercial properties. Lenders use property valuations to assess the risk associated with providing mortgage loans.

Furthermore, commercial property valuation plays a vital role in legal disputes and litigation cases. Valuations may be required for property settlements in divorce cases or determining compensation in eminent domain cases.
